WhatsApp: +86 18221755073A gold carbonaceous sulphide ore from California carrying free gold yielded a 93 per cent recovery into a concentrate at 14.4:1 to ratio of concentration after conditioning with 0.50 lb. per ton of reagent 645. In each case the ore was ground to about 70 per cent minus 200 mesh and conditioned at 22 per cent solids with the reagents as indicated.

WhatsApp: +86 18221755073Gold-bearing ores are natural mineral formations (ore) containing gold in quantities that make gold extraction economically feasible. A distinction is made between primary deposits (including veins with a gold content of 1...30 g/t) and alluvium placers (gold content of 0.5...50 g/m³).
